DESCRIPTION:No. 41895
Mineral:Zincite (man-made)
Locality:Silesia, Poland
Description:Neon-orange transparent zincite crystals with lustrous faces and mounted to an acrylic base for display. These zincite crystals are supposedly recovered from the chimney walls at the zinc smelter. Hard to obtain now because they are used in metaphysics. Ex. Robert C. Lambert (1919-2008) #199
Overall Size:9.5x3x2 cm
Crystals:1-95 mm
